A construction quality management plan is essential for architecture and project management, as it outlines the specific quality control processes for construction projects, ensuring that every aspect meets the contract specifications and agreed-upon quality standards.
Quality management plays a crucial role in the success of construction projects. Without proper quality control measures in place, standards can easily decline, particularly when working with contractors on large-scale initiatives.
